Not quite.  Just filing from both sides will never get you an optimal point (or frog).

The point rail gets slightly bent at the end so the the web lines up with the side you wouldn't normally file (the 'inside' part of the point rail).  Then the rail head is filed back straight to the rest of the rail.  Then you can proceed to file from the other side (stock rail side) and it will never cut into the web.  This also leaves extra base rail to solder to the throwbar.

You bend so the middle of the web is on the edge of the rail head.  That's .013" (half the rail head width).  Normal rail base is 0.21".  So even though it's still a small amount, relatively speaking it's quite a bit (165% ?).

Now someone else is having trouble with numbers. I don't know what rail you're using, but the Code 55 I have has a base of 0.055", coincidentally. If I file away half of the rail, that's 0.028" of base left.

The rail head I measure at 0.028", and the web at 0.012". The head is 0.016" wider than the web; if I bend the rail so the side of the web aligns with the side of where the head was, then I bend it only 0.008" (0.028" - 0.012" / 2, or the difference between the side of the head and the side of the web). That's a mighty shallow bend, by the way--would love to know how you measure it.

Utilizing the bend, the base grows from 0.028" to 0.036". That's a 28% increase--hardly 165%. Also note that you do not gain half the width of the head, because you're still filing some of the head away on both sides.

Just for giggles, you might want to download Proto87 Stores pdf file for a #6 template, to see the difference between what building your turnouts to NMRA and Fast Tracks specs, and building them to more prototypical tie spacing, switch and frog proportions looks like to your eye.  I'm not gonna say that you'll see a big difference, but there definitely IS a difference, which you may find to your liking, or not.

I find that smashing about 3/8 to 1/2" of solder with my flat-nose pliers, then splitting that with my Xacto makes solder control easier.  Give it a try.

As to my individual tastes and practices for turnout switches:
My last dozen turnouts don't have soldered points at the PCB throwbar either.  I like the new "solution" much better from an operational, reliability and appearance standpoint.

I do order and use Andy Reichert's (Proto87Stores.com) etched NS headblock/hinge/throwbar cause they're cheap. look great and work great too.

However, I DO the point-bendy thing on all my closure points.  Just the way I learned to do 'em from Gordy (I think).  Doesn't take any longer.

The last dozen turnouts don't have the inside rail foot on the stock rails filed away either (hate the way that looks).  I started buying Proto87 Stores' "tri-planed closure points-short" for my turnouts.  Spendy little buggers at ten bucks a pair, but they're worth it until I can figure a way to make my own.  Since I bought all of my PCB tie material and rail years ago, I'm still saving a significant amount.
